Adjacent Landowners can participate in an agreement to develop a celebration wall surface. The parties can agree that the wall surface is to be found ashore possessed totally by among them or that it is to stand partly, generally similarly, on both parcels. Under a typical plan, one party constructs the wall surface and the other adds to its building and construction. The celebrations can likewise concur that an existing separating wall surface is to become a party wall. Your houses in the Back Bay are developed practically solely with common side wall surfaces, called event walls or dividers wall surfaces, in between them. The wall surfaces are usually one foot thick, made of brick, and positioned so that they straddle the residential property line with fifty percent on each side. Q: For how long does the Party Wall process generally take? A: The Event Wall Honor normally takes 4 to 6 weeks gave the Building Owner has all the illustrations and information ready and the Adjoining Proprietor works together. Where there are two surveyors, the procedure is normally a little slower than with a solitary Agreed Surveyor.
